Description:

FZ/T 60320-2021 4-Strand Mix Polyolefin Fibre Rope is made up of shall be constructed using bi-component fibres made of a blend during extrusion of polypropylene and of polyethylene , with a minimum of 15 % and a maximum of 50 % of polyethylene. FZ/T 60320-2021 4-Strand Mix Polyolefin Fibre Rope can be widely used in ocean transportation, petrochemical vessels and other fields. It has UV resistance abrasion,chemical resistance,high tenacity .Its perfect comninmation and construction creats the rope with much lower elongation, when we use it, it make sure the rope have better stability and safety.

Main Technical Parameters:

Linear density and minimum breaking force of 4-strand shroud-laid mixed polyolefin fibre ropes (type A)

Reference NO.1 Linear density2.3 Minimum breaking strength kN4.5
Nominal
ktex
Tolerance
%
Unspliced ropes Ropes with eye-spliced terminations
6 16.3 ±10 6.08 5.47
8 29.0 10.5 9.45
10 45.3 ±8 16.2 14.6
12 65.2 22.9 20.6
14 88.8 30.6 27.5
16 116 ±5 39.2 35.2
18 147 49.1 44.2
20 181 59.6 53.6
22 219 71.2 64.1
24 261 83.5 75.2
26 306 96.3 86.7
28 355 111 100
30 408 126 113
32 464 141 127
36 587 175 158
40 725 211 190
44 877 249 224
48 1040 293 264
52 1220 338 304
56 1420 386 347
60 1630 437 393
64 1860 490 441
68 2100 548 493
72 2350 609 548
80 2900 736 662
88 3510 887 798
96 4170 1059 945

1.The reference number corresponds to the approximate diameter, in millimetres.

2. The linear density, in kilotex, corresponds to the net mass per length of the rope, expressed in grams per metre or in kilograms per kilometre.

3. The linear density is obtained under reference tension and is measured as specified in GB/T8834.

4. The breaking forces relate to new, dry and wet ropes.

5. A force determined by the test methods specified in GB/T8834 is not necessarily an accurate indication of the force at which that rope might break in other circumstances and situations. The type and quality of terminations, the rate of force application, prior conditioning and previous force applications to the rope can significantly influence the breaking force. A rope bent around a post, capstan, pulley or sheave may break at a significantly lower force. A knot or other distortion in a rope may significantly reduce the breaking force.
